Name Years served UN Secretary(ies)-General U.S. President(s)
Edward R. Stettinius, Jr. 1945 - 1946 Trygve Lie Harry S. Truman
Herschel V. Johnson
(acting)
1946 - 1947 Trygve Lie Harry S. Truman
Warren R. Austin 1947 - 1953 Trygve Lie, Dag Hammarskjöld Harry S. Truman
Henry Cabot Lodge, Jr. 1953 - 1960 Dag Hammarskjöld Dwight Eisenhower
James J. Wadsworth 1960 - 1961 Dag Hammarskjöld Dwight Eisenhower
Adlai Stevenson 1961 - 1965 Dag Hammarskjöld, U Thant John F. Kennedy, Lyndon Johnson
Arthur J. Goldberg 1965 - 1968 U Thant Lyndon Johnson
George W. Ball 1968 U Thant Lyndon Johnson
James Russell Wiggins 1968 - 1969 U Thant Lyndon Johnson
Charles W. Yost 1969 - 1971 U Thant Richard Nixon
George H. W. Bush 1971 - 1973 U Thant, Kurt Waldheim Richard Nixon
John A. Scali 1973 - 1975 Kurt Waldheim Richard Nixon, Gerald Ford
Daniel Patrick Moynihan 1975 - 1976 Kurt Waldheim Gerald Ford
William Scranton 1976 - 1977 Kurt Waldheim Gerald Ford
Andrew Young 1977 - 1979 Kurt Waldheim Jimmy Carter
Donald McHenry 1979 - 1981 Kurt Waldheim Jimmy Carter
Jeane Kirkpatrick 1981 - 1985 Kurt Waldheim Ronald Reagan
Vernon A. Walters 1985 - 1989 Kurt Waldheim, Javier Pérez de Cuéllar Ronald Reagan
Thomas R. Pickering 1989 - 1992 Javier Pérez de Cuéllar, Boutros Boutros-Ghali George H. W. Bush
Edward J. Perkins 1992 - 1993 Boutros Boutros-Ghali George H. W. Bush
Madeleine Albright 1993 - 1997 Boutros Boutros-Ghali Bill Clinton
Bill Richardson 1997 - 1998 Kofi Annan Bill Clinton
A. Peter Burleigh
(acting)
1998 - 1999 Kofi Annan Bill Clinton
Richard Holbrooke 1999 - 2001 Kofi Annan Bill Clinton
James B. Cunningham
(acting)
2001 Kofi Annan George W. Bush
John D. Negroponte 2001 - 2004 Kofi Annan George W. Bush
John Danforth 2004 - 2005 Kofi Annan George W. Bush
Anne W. Patterson
(Acting)
2005 Kofi Annan George W. Bush
John R. Bolton 2005 - Present Kofi Annan George W. Bush
